Miracle Box version 3.40 (often referred to as Miracle Thunder 3.40) serves as a multi-functional mobile utility tool primarily used for unlocking, flashing, and repairing Android devices.

The "deep feature" included in this transition from version 3.39 to 3.40 refers to enhanced capabilities for direct memory manipulation, which allows technicians to perform repairs on devices that cannot be fixed through standard USB flashing. Why the Miracle Box 3.40 Update Matters

Before diving into the technicalities, let us address the "why." Miracle Box has long been a powerhouse for Qualcomm, MTK (MediaTek), Spreadtrum (Unisoc), and Android utility tasks. However, the landscape of mobile devices is constantly changing. New security patches, bootloader locks, and proprietary protocols emerge every month.
